The first theme is women’s suffrage, in honor of the 100th anniversary of the 19th Amendment.

 

The struggle for the vote was long and hard fought. Even in winning the vote, not all women were able to access their new enfranchisement for decades, and some communities still struggle with voting rights and access today. Kansas was forefront in the fight for women’s suffrage, extending the right to vote to Kansas women eight years before the ratification of the 19th Amendment in 1920.
